a line that is not straight but bends in a smooth and continuous way
curve, curved shape(noun)the trace of a point whose direction of motion changes
curve(noun)a line on a graph representing data
curve, curve ball, breaking ball, bender(noun)a pitch of a baseball that is thrown with spin so that its path curves as it approaches the batter
curvature, curve(noun)the property possessed by the curving of a line or surface
bend, curve(verb)curved segment (of a road or river or railroad track etc.)
swerve, sheer, curve, trend, veer, slue, slew, cut(verb)turn sharply; change direction abruptly
"The car cut to the left at the intersection"; "The motorbike veered to the right"
wind, twist, curve(verb)extend in curves and turns
"The road winds around the lake"; "the path twisted through the forest"
arch, curve, arc(verb)form an arch or curve
"her back arches"; "her hips curve nicely"
crook, curve(verb)bend or cause to bend
"He crooked his index finger"; "the road curved sharply"
curl, curve, kink(verb)form a curl, curve, or kink
"the cigar smoke curled up at the ceiling"
